Dangerous Drugs Lawyers

If you've been injured by prescription medications that have unknown side effects, you could seek compensation through a dangerous drug lawsuit. A lawyer who specializes on prescription drug cases can help you in fighting for the compensation you're entitled to.

Dangerous drugs can cause serious injuries and permanent damage that require expensive medical treatment in the form of pain and suffering and loss of income. Contact a dangerous drug lawyer to get a free review of your claim.

Medical Devices

Medications are a crucial part of treating patients however, they also cause serious injuries or death. Patients who are injured due to unsafe medications need to make a claim for compensation to pay medical bills as well as suffering, pain, loss of wages and, in some cases, funeral expenses. Most victims are capable of filing a claim with the help of a dangerous drug lawyer who has experience in handling these cases.

Different types of medicines can harm patients in different ways. Certain medications can cause adverse reactions when used in conjunction with other drugs or food, whereas others can have serious side effects which may result in severe injuries or even death. The drugs that are most hazardous include steroids, antidepressants, pain relievers birth control pills and opioids. Certain of these drugs have been linked to increased risks for heart attacks, strokes lung disease kidney disease and diabetes.

Drug manufacturers have a responsibility to test their products and avoid selling drugs that present significant risks to patients. Unfortunately, many companies ignore their obligations and continue to sell drugs that have dangerous adverse effects or are unsafe for certain patients. Some of these companies have even bypassed FDA's rigorous approval processes by applying for fast status. Examples of this include SSRI (sel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or) Zoloft, which was associated with birth defects in some women who took it during the first 20 weeks of pregnancy.

Sometimes the reason that an ingredient causes harm is due to the way it was developed or manufactured. In these instances a lawyer for dangerous drugs will determine if there's a safer design alternative and hold the manufacturer accountable for not using it.

A number of pharmaceutical companies were forced to recall defective products, including metal-on-metal replacement hips, transvaginal lace and surgical sutures. These devices are recalled when they cause serious complications such as bleeding or infections around the implant. These defective devices could cause injuries or even deaths when approved for use off-label that is, they are FDA approved but used for a different condition than the one they were originally prescribed for. A New York dangerous drug lawyer can assist you in obtaining the maximum settlement in this type of case.

Prescription Drugs

In the United States, many people use prescription and over-the-counter medicines to treat symptoms or illnesses. Unfortunately, these drugs can be dangerous drugs lawsuit for some patients and can cause serious injuries. Prescription and OTC drugs that are prescribed by a physician or purchased from a retail store they can trigger serious side effects like seizures, blood pressure issues, liver and kidney damage, among others. A dangerous drug lawyer can assist you with filing a claim if someone you love has been injured by an medication.

A variety of prescription medications can be harmful for patients, such as antidepressants, painkillers and relaxers, and many other medications. These substances can trigger serious side effects that could be fatal if used in large quantities or combined with other medications. Some drugs are also dangerous to use for long durations of time, such as opioids like fentanyl, which has been linked to a number of overdose deaths in recent times.

There are many ways a person can be harmed by a dangerous drug for example, when a doctor prescribes the wrong dose or medication, or when the pharmacy, hospital, or other healthcare facility makes a mistake in filling prescriptions. However, the vast majority of lawsuits involving dangerous drugs are involving claims against pharmaceutical companies - an organization of corporations collectively referred to as "big pharma."

When big pharma hides serious adverse effects from the FDA or consumers, it can cause injuries that are devastating to individuals and their families. A dangerous drugs lawyer can assist injured clients in filing a lawsuit against the company responsible for the manufacturing of defective drugs.

Victims of dangerous drugs are usually entitled to compensation, which includes for medical expenses and lost income. This is particularly true in cases where the drug has been recalled and removed from the shelves. In these cases the plaintiff who has been injured may be able join a class-action lawsuit along with other patients who suffered similarly.

It is crucial to discuss your potential case with a dangerous drug lawyer as quickly as you can. You might not be able to claim compensation for your injuries if do not consult a lawyer. You could also miss important details of your case.

Pharmaceutical Companies

When most people think of dangerous drugs, they think of illegal drug abuse or prescription medication with unreported side consequences. However, dangerous drugs can also be FDA-approved medications prescribed to patients. The FDA requires that manufacturers test drugs and warn of potential dangers, but many companies do not adhere to these requirements. It is not uncommon for pharmaceutical companies to conceal information or skip tests to speedily get a new drug on the market. In decades of mass tort litigation, it has been demonstrated that pharmaceutical companies often make money before ensuring the safety of consumers.

The FDA is usually only alerted to potentially dangerous drugs when a large number patients report adverse effects. Unfortunately, by this point, it is often too late to help affected victims. A defective lawsuit against a drug could allow victims to receive compensation for medical expenses or lost income, as well as discomfort and pain.

Our New York dangerous drugs lawyers can help you file an action against a drug company for the harms that their defective products caused. We can determine whether you have a valid claim and pursue the maximum amount of compensation to cover the damages.

We can sue a pharmaceutical company individually or join with thousands of other plaintiffs in an action class or multidistrict lawsuit against a multinational corporation. These cases are usually brought together before a federal judge and this allows us to create a formidable front against the multibillion dollar drug corporations.

A wrongful death suit can be filed against a drug company to recover the loss of a loved one because of a dangerous drug. This is because a company is required to warn the deceased of risks that are known to be present. This duty does not end once the product is released.

The FDA has some flaws in its system, which allow unsafe medicines to enter doctors' offices and hospitals. For instance the 501(k) approval program allows drug manufacturers to bypass rigorous testing and release their products straight to the market. Certain products that have been linked with recent recalls of high-profile like metal-on-metal hip replacements and transvaginal mesh, got their initial FDA approval using this loophole.

Drug Recalls

In the United States, most people use at least one prescription medication or an over-the-counter medication. Medical professionals examine and decide safe most medications before they are released to the market. However, problems can occur during or after manufacturing which could render a drug unfit for use. These problems can range from tampering to mislabeling.

A manufacturer can recall a product or remove it from the market if they discover a possible danger. A class I recall is issued when there is a significant risk that a drug could cause serious health issues or even death. A class II recall occurs when there is only an extremely small chance that the drug may cause temporary or treatable problems. A class III recall is when the issue with a medication is not serious and does not pose any immediate dangers to patients.

Once a drug has been removed from the market, it has to be removed from the shelves and given to hospitals and pharmacies until the issue is fixed. Anyone who is prescribed to a drug listed on the list is encouraged to consult with their physician regarding alternative treatments. If you've used an OTC drug and have noticed that it's been recalled contact the manufacturer or FDA.

It is crucial to get in touch with an New York dangerous drug lawyer immediately if you've been injured by a dangerous substance or defective product. You could be able to get compensation for your financial and non-financial losses.

Dangerous drug lawsuits may be filed on an individual basis or as part of an action class. In the second scenario you'll be a part of a group with other people who were injured by the same device or medication and share any profits.
